A 1.5-volt battery provides a lower voltage compared to a 9-volt battery, meaning it delivers less electrical potential energy. This difference in voltage affects the type of devices each battery can power; 1.5-volt batteries are commonly used in small electronics like remote controls and toys, while 9-volt batteries are used in devices that require higher power, such as smoke detectors and guitar pedals. Additionally, 9-volt batteries typically have a larger physical size and capacity compared to 1.5-volt batteries.

A circuit with a 1.5-volt battery will provide less electrical potential, resulting in lower current and reduced power output compared to a circuit with a 9-volt battery. This means that devices designed for 9 volts will generally operate more efficiently and at higher performance levels than those designed for 1.5 volts. However, using a 9-volt battery in a device that requires only 1.5 volts can damage the device due to excessive voltage. Thus, it's essential to match the battery voltage to the requirements of the circuit.
